How to connect Microsoft Teams and Odoo
Create a New Scenario to Connect Microsoft Teams and Odoo
In the workspace, click the “Create New Scenario” button.

Add the First Step
Add the first node – a trigger that will initiate the scenario when it receives the required event. Triggers can be scheduled, called by a Microsoft Teams, triggered by another scenario, or executed manually (for testing purposes). In most cases, Microsoft Teams or Odoo will be your first step. To do this, click "Choose an app," find Microsoft Teams or Odoo, and select the appropriate trigger to start the scenario.

Save and Activate the Scenario
After configuring Microsoft Teams, Odoo,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.
Test the Scenario
Run the scenario by clicking “Run once” and triggering an event to check if the Microsoft Teams and Odoo integ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between Microsoft Teams and Odoo (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.

Are there any limitations to the Microsoft Teams and Odoo integration on Latenode?
While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:
- Real-time updates may experience slight delays due to API rate limits.
- Complex Odoo custom fields might require custom JavaScript mapping.
- Large file transfers between apps could impact workflow performance.
